1. Cost Savings:
A home energy assessment provides a comprehensive overview of your home's energy performance. It can help identify areas of energy inefficiency so you can come up with an action plan for reducing your energy costs. Many of the suggested improvements may qualify you for rebates or lower energy costs, so you can recover the costs of the assessment quickly.
2. Increased Comfort:
A home energy assessment can help you determine what changes will make the biggest impact on your comfort level. This can include updating insulation, adjusting the thermostat, or adding window treatments. After making the suggested improvements, you'll be able to enjoy a warmer, more comfortable house without the extra energy costs.
